#Causes_and_Repercussions


Under the patronage of the Municipal Council of Al-Asabia and the University of Gharyan, the College of Arts Al-Asabia and the College of Sciences Al-Asabia organized a scientific symposium titled "Fires in Al-Asabia City: Causes and Repercussions" in the meeting hall of the Municipal Council.

The symposium featured an elite group of faculty members from the universities of Gharyan, Zintan, and Tripoli, as well as the Libyan Intellectuals Association and several research centers.


Symposium Themes:


Crisis Management and Efforts During the Disaster – Eng. Emad Al-Maqtouf


Spatial Distribution of Fires – Dr. Ibrahim Al-Saghir


Fires from a Geological Perspective – Dr. Osama Ahmed Hilal


Spontaneous Fires Throughout History – Dr. Al-Dhawi Ali Al-Muntasir


Impact of Al-Asabia Fires on Environment and Society and Mitigation Methods – Dr. Ali Ayyad Al-Kabir


Al-Asabia Fires from a Scientific Perspective – Dr. Salim Rahima Salim


Media Discourse During Crises – Dr. Mohammed Ibrahim Al-Lafi


The Truth About Jinn Harming Humans and Prevention Methods – Dr. Abdulmajeed Al-Rahibi


This symposium is part of scientific and research efforts to understand the causes of the phenomenon, discuss its environmental and social repercussions, and propose scientific and practical solutions to address its future impacts.


Opinions on the causes varied, each according to their perspective and beliefs. Determining the definitive causes remains an area requiring further research, without excluding any factor that may have a direct or indirect influence on this phenomenon. Several researchers emphasized the necessity of studying the phenomenon from both the religious standpoint adopted by some reformers and the scientific approach subject to measurement and scrutiny. Participants commended the efforts of all entities advocating for real solutions to halt this phenomenon.


Participants decided to hold another scientific symposium after conducting religious, scientific, and social studies. The recommendations will be sent to the Ministry of Higher Education and Scientific Research and the Government of National Unity for urgent and necessary action.
